Farmer electrocuted by snapped live wire in his field in Anantapur district

A 60-year-old farmer named Adinarayana was electrocuted in Anantapur district after coming into contact with a snapped live wire in his field. Local police have registered a case and sent the body for a post-mortem examination.

A 60-year-old farmer was electrocuted while watering his field in Turakapalle village of Peddapappuru mandal in Anantapur district on Wednesday (September 9, 2026) morning.
The deceased was identified as Adinarayana. The police said he came in contact with a snapped live wire lying in his groundnut field.
The body was sent to the government hospital in Tadipatri for post-mortem. A case has been registered.
